The phrase "a need for strong" is not complete and lacks context, making it difficult to assess its correctness in written English.
It could be used in contexts discussing the necessity for strong qualities, actions, or attributes, but it requires additional information to clarify its meaning.
Example: "There is a need for strong leadership in times of crisis."
Alternatives: "a demand for robust" or "a requirement for powerful".
